APK409S A DDNAME FOR {MSGDD ¦ PARMDD}
WAS NOT SUPPLIED. {SYSPRINT ¦
SYSIN} WAS USED.
Explanation: No DDname was specified for either the
MSGDD or the PARMDD parameter.
System Action: If the missing DDname was MSGDD,
the DDname assigned to SYSPRINT was used. If the
missing DDname was PARMDD, the DDname assigned
to SYSIN was used.
User Response: If the DDname used was not
acceptable, specify a DDname for the parameter and
submit the job again.
System Programmer Response: No response is
necessary.
APK410S AN ACIF STORAGE REQUEST WAS
UNSUCCESSFUL - REQUEST SIZE

storage request size

,

request type

RETURN
CODE

return code

.
Explanation: An unsuccessful attempt has been made
to obtain/free ACIF subpool storage. This error
message returns the following information:
Storage request size
Request type
Return code
System Action: ACIF terminates.
User Response: No response is necessary.
System Programmer Response: Use the information
provided in the message to correct the error and
resubmit the job.
APK411S AN ERROR OCCURRED WHILE
ATTEMPTING TO { READ FROM¦WRITE
TO¦CLOSE } THE DDNAME

xxxxxxxx

,
RETURN CODE

return code

.
Explanation: The file I/O macro made an
unsuccessful attempt to write to the named DD. The
return codes are listed below:
System Action: ACIF terminates.
User Response: Use the information provided in the
return code to correct the problem.
System Programmer Response: No response is
necessary.
APK412W MODULE

module name

HAS RETURNED
WITH RETURN CODE

return code.

Explanation: A non-zero return code has been
returned from the called module. This message
indicates that an abnormal occurrence has taken place
in the called module. This message is informational
and further action will take place in higher level modules
if required.
System Action: None; this message is for information
only.
User Response: See the accompanying message to
determine a response.
System Programmer Response: No response is
necessary.
Return Codes
0 - Successful
1 - Permanent I/O
error
2 - Specified number
of bytes is zero or
negative
3 - Invalid data buffer
address
4 - Address not word
aligned
6 - Invalid FILE_CB@
7 - Invalid MODE
parameter
8 - Data record longer
than LRECL or
buffer
9 - File is not
supported type
10 - Storage
allocation/deallocation
failed
11 - Invalid record
number
12 - End of file
detected
13 - Disk is full
14 - RECFM invalid
20 - Invalid file id
28 - File not found
51 - Length exceeds
maximum
310 - File format invalid
